Nice easy recipe. I don't usually do easy, but I am 5 months pregnant and kind of lazy right now. One tip...although it doesn't say, make sure you soften the cream cheese. I softened mine, but apparently not enough. I imagine you would have to near melt it to get it to completely blend with the cool whip. Very yummy though!
